Watch Bon Iver and members of The National play together in Paris
The collaboration came as part of Bryce Dessner’s Invisible Bridge concert.
The National’s Bryce Dessner performed a special concert in Paris this week, called Invisible Bridge. During the show, he was joined by his brother and bandmate Aaron, as well as Justin Vernon of Bon Iver.
The trio played ‘Hazelton’, from Vernon’s 2006 solo EP ‘Hazeltons’, with Vernon also playing ‘Babys’ from Bon Iver’s ‘Blood Bank’ EP, and an unreleased track from the band’s upcoming third album, ‘00000 Million’.
Bon Iver’s third album ‘22, A Million’ is set to be released this Friday (30th September), and last night (26th September), its fourth track ‘8 (Circle)’ was released.
